The Nassau Hockey League is open to boys and girls living in and around Hopewell Valley, New Jersey, and provides an alternative to the more intense programs offered by some other leagues in the area. The charter of the Nassau Hockey League is to create a relaxed environment for the kids and to teach them to skate, play the game and have a good time. The key to this successful tradition has been the restraint and support of the parents in creating and maintaining a constructive, low key atmosphere at the rink.

Our season runs from October through to March. Registration takes place in August. Most of our games are played at the Princeton Day School rink  with additional regular ice sessions at Princeton Sports Center and occasionally at The Lawrenceville School.

As well as the popular and successful house league program, the Nassau Hockey League has travel teams in all age groups from Mites (8 and under) through to Midgets (15 to 18 year-olds) Try-outs for these teams are open to all members(boys and girls) and are held before the regular season begins.

A team jersey will be provided for all House League team members. The jersey is yours to keep. Required equipment includes hockey skates, hockey helmet with full face mask, shin guards, hockey gloves, elbow pads and ice hockey stick. Older members should also wear shoulder pads, protective cup, hockey pants and a mouth guard. Please email us if you have any questions, we know how mysterious hockey equipment can be to parents. New equipment can be purchased at major sporting stores in the area and some stores may offer discounts to NHL members. Used equipment can often be obtained at substantial savings at various sporting sales, garage sales or from parents of players.

ADULT VOLUNTEERS: All parents interested in coaching or assisting in any way are invited to indicate your interest on the application. As part of our insurance coverage, all coaches are required to complete the USA Hockey form prior to the start of the season. In addition, all volunteers must wear helmets when helping out on the ice. The USA Hockey coaches fee will be reimbursed by the league.
